Q1: What units should I use for volume and density?
A: Volume should be in cubic meters (m³) and density in tons per cubic meter (tons/m³) for consistent results.
Q2: How do I convert other units to m³ and tons/m³?
A: Use appropriate conversion factors. For example, 1 cubic foot = 0.0283168 m³, and 1 kg/m³ = 0.001 tons/m³.
